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it e9c068b2 authored by Steven Moreland's avatar Steven Moreland Committed by android-build-merger
Browse files

Merge "Revert "(lib)?sensorservice: Android.mk -> Android.bp"" am: c6a6fd05

am: 4fe57dd5

Change-Id: Ie46dfeb8c57c4edeedbf474a7f5cb414e3ab686e
parents 03e80b46 4fe57dd5
Loading
Loading
Loading
Loading

services/sensorservice/Android.bp

deleted100644 → 0
+0 −59
Original line number Diff line number Diff line
cc_library_shared {
    name: "libsensorservice",

    srcs: [
        "BatteryService.cpp",
        "CorrectedGyroSensor.cpp",
        "Fusion.cpp",
        "GravitySensor.cpp",
        "LinearAccelerationSensor.cpp",
        "OrientationSensor.cpp",
        "RecentEventLogger.cpp",
        "RotationVectorSensor.cpp",
        "SensorDevice.cpp",
        "SensorEventConnection.cpp",
        "SensorFusion.cpp",
        "SensorInterface.cpp",
        "SensorList.cpp",
        "SensorRecord.cpp",
        "SensorService.cpp",
        "SensorServiceUtils.cpp",
    ],

    cflags: [
        "-DLOG_TAG=\"SensorService\"",
        "-Wall",
        "-Werror",
        "-Wextra",
        "-fvisibility=hidden",
    ],

    shared_libs: [
        "libcutils",
        "libhardware",
        "libhardware_legacy",
        "libutils",
        "liblog",
        "libbinder",
        "libui",
        "libgui",
        "libcrypto",
    ],
}

cc_binary {
    name: "sensorservice",
    srcs: ["main_sensorservice.cpp"],

    shared_libs: [
        "libsensorservice",
        "libbinder",
        "libutils",
    ],

    cflags: [
        "-Wall",
        "-Werror",
        "-Wextra",
    ],
}
+62 −0
Original line number Diff line number Diff line
LOCAL_PATH:= $(call my-dir)
include $(CLEAR_VARS)

LOCAL_SRC_FILES:= \
    BatteryService.cpp \
    CorrectedGyroSensor.cpp \
    Fusion.cpp \
    GravitySensor.cpp \
    LinearAccelerationSensor.cpp \
    OrientationSensor.cpp \
    RecentEventLogger.cpp \
    RotationVectorSensor.cpp \
    SensorDevice.cpp \
    SensorEventConnection.cpp \
    SensorFusion.cpp \
    SensorInterface.cpp \
    SensorList.cpp \
    SensorRecord.cpp \
    SensorService.cpp \
    SensorServiceUtils.cpp \


LOCAL_CFLAGS:= -DLOG_TAG=\"SensorService\"

LOCAL_CFLAGS += -Wall -Werror -Wextra

LOCAL_CFLAGS += -fvisibility=hidden

LOCAL_SHARED_LIBRARIES := \
    libcutils \
    libhardware \
    libhardware_legacy \
    libutils \
    liblog \
    libbinder \
    libui \
    libgui \
    libcrypto

LOCAL_MODULE:= libsensorservice

include $(BUILD_SHARED_LIBRARY)

#####################################################################
# build executable
include $(CLEAR_VARS)

LOCAL_SRC_FILES:= \
    main_sensorservice.cpp

LOCAL_SHARED_LIBRARIES := \
    libsensorservice \
    libbinder \
    libutils

LOCAL_CFLAGS := -Wall -Werror -Wextra

LOCAL_MODULE_TAGS := optional

LOCAL_MODULE:= sensorservice

include $(BUILD_EXECUTABLE)